- Add patch to fix icewm session desktop files
* icewm-session-desktop.patch OBS-URL: https://build.opensuse.org/package/show/X11:windowmanagers/icewm?expand=0&rev=58
This commit is contained in:
parent
1382ccc4c4
commit
5b630fcd46
116
icewm-session-desktop.patch
Normal file
116
icewm-session-desktop.patch
Normal file
@ -0,0 +1,116 @@
|
||||
From b127566dfbdd985cd5632fe3686c77fa7f0d56b3 Mon Sep 17 00:00:00 2001
|
||||
From: Brian Bidulock <bidulock@openss7.org>
|
||||
Date: Wed, 10 Feb 2016 11:51:45 -0700
|
||||
Subject: [PATCH] proper XSession .desktop files
|
||||
|
||||
---
|
||||
lib/icewm-session.desktop | 58 +++++++++++++++++++++++++++++++++++++++++++----
|
||||
lib/icewm.desktop | 26 +++++++++++++++++++++
|
||||
4 files changed, 82 insertions(+), 4 deletions(-)
|
||||
create mode 100644 lib/icewm.desktop
|
||||
|
||||
Index: icewm-1.3.12/lib/icewm-session.desktop
|
||||
===================================================================
|
||||
--- icewm-1.3.12.orig/lib/icewm-session.desktop
|
||||
+++ icewm-1.3.12/lib/icewm-session.desktop
|
||||
@@ -1,12 +1,62 @@
|
||||
[Desktop Entry]
|
||||
-Version=1.0
|
||||
Encoding=UTF-8
|
||||
Type=XSession
|
||||
Name=IceWM Session
|
||||
-Comment=Simple and fast window manger
|
||||
-Terminal=false
|
||||
+GenericName=Window Manager
|
||||
+GenericName[fr]=Gestionnaire de Fenêtres
|
||||
+GenericName[pt]=Gestor de Janelas
|
||||
+Comment=This session logs you into IceWM
|
||||
+Comment[az]=Bu iclas sizi Icewm'a daxil edəcək
|
||||
+Comment[be]=Гэтая сэсыя завядзе вас у Icewm
|
||||
+Comment[ca]=Aquesta sessió entra en Icewm
|
||||
+Comment[cs]=Toto sezení vás přihlásí do Icewm
|
||||
+Comment[cy]=Mae'r sesiwn hwn yn eich mewngofnodi i Icewm
|
||||
+Comment[da]=Denne session logger dig på Icewm
|
||||
+Comment[de]=Diese Sitzung meldet Sie an Icewm an
|
||||
+Comment[el]=Αυτή η συνεδρία σας εισάγει στο Icewm
|
||||
+Comment[es]=Con esta sesión accede a Icewm
|
||||
+Comment[fi]=Tämä istunto kirjaa sisään Icewmen
|
||||
+Comment[fr]=Cette session vous connectera dans Icewm
|
||||
+Comment[he]=תצורת הפעלה זו מחברת אותך ל Icewm
|
||||
+Comment[hi]=यह सत्र गनोम में लॉगिन होगा
|
||||
+Comment[hu]=Ez a munkamenet a Icewm-ba jelentkeztet be
|
||||
+Comment[it]=Sessione di lavoro con Icewm
|
||||
+Comment[ja]=Icewm セッションにログインします
|
||||
+Comment[ko]=Icewm세션으로 로그인합니다
|
||||
+Comment[ms]=Sesi ini akan log anda ke Icewm
|
||||
+Comment[nl]=Deze sessie meldt u aan bij Icewm
|
||||
+Comment[nn]=Denne økta loggar på Icewm
|
||||
+Comment[no]=Denne sesjonen logger deg inn til Icewm
|
||||
+Comment[pl]=Sesja logowania do Icewm
|
||||
+Comment[pt]=Esta sessão inicia-o no Icewm
|
||||
+Comment[pt_BR]=Logar no ambiente Icewm
|
||||
+Comment[ro]=Această sesiune vă va loga în Icewm
|
||||
+Comment[sk]=Toto sedenie vás prihlási do prostredia Icewm
|
||||
+Comment[sl]=Ta seja vas prijavi v Icewm
|
||||
+Comment[sq]=Kjo seancë do t'ju fusë në Icewm
|
||||
+Comment[sr@Latn]=Ova sesija vas prijavljuje na Icewm
|
||||
+Comment[sr]=Ова сесија вас пријављује на Icewm
|
||||
+Comment[sv]=Denna session loggar in dig i Icewm
|
||||
+Comment[tr]=Bu oturum ile Icewm'a giriş yaparsınız
|
||||
+Comment[uk]=Сеанс роботи в середовищі Icewm
|
||||
+Comment[vi]=Session này cho bạn đăng nhập vào Icewm
|
||||
+Comment[zh_CN]=此会话使您登录到 Icewm
|
||||
+Comment[zh_TW]=選取這個作業階段後會進入 Icewm 環境
|
||||
+Icon=icewm
|
||||
+TryExec=/usr/bin/icewm-session
|
||||
Exec=icewm-session
|
||||
-TryExec=icewm-session
|
||||
+NoDisplay=true
|
||||
+Hidden=true
|
||||
+Categories=WindowManager;Application;System;
|
||||
+StartupNotify=false
|
||||
+X-GNOME-Autostart-Notify=false
|
||||
+X-GNOME-Autostart-Phase=WindowManager
|
||||
+X-GNOME-Provides=windowmanager
|
||||
+X-GNOME-WMName=icewm
|
||||
+DesktopNames=ICEWM
|
||||
+X-LightDM-DesktopName=icewm
|
||||
|
||||
[Window Manager]
|
||||
+Name=icewm
|
||||
SessionManaged=true
|
||||
+StartupNotification=false
|
||||
Index: icewm-1.3.12/lib/icewm.desktop
|
||||
===================================================================
|
||||
--- icewm-1.3.12.orig/lib/icewm.desktop
|
||||
+++ icewm-1.3.12/lib/icewm.desktop
|
||||
@@ -1,8 +1,26 @@
|
||||
[Desktop Entry]
|
||||
-Version=1.0
|
||||
Encoding=UTF-8
|
||||
-Type=Application
|
||||
+Type=XSession
|
||||
Name=IceWM
|
||||
+GenericName=Window Manager
|
||||
+GenericName[fr]=Gestionnaire de Fenêtres
|
||||
+GenericName[pt]=Gestor de Janelas
|
||||
Comment=Simple and fast window manger
|
||||
+Icon=icewm
|
||||
+TryExec=/usr/bin/icewm
|
||||
Exec=icewm
|
||||
-TryExec=icewm
|
||||
+NoDisplay=true
|
||||
+Hidden=true
|
||||
+Categories=WindowManager;Application;System;
|
||||
+StartupNotify=false
|
||||
+X-GNOME-Autostart-Notify=false
|
||||
+X-GNOME-Autostart-Phase=WindowManager
|
||||
+X-GNOME-Provides=windowmanager
|
||||
+X-GNOME-WMName=icewm
|
||||
+DesktopNames=ICEWM
|
||||
+X-LightDM-DesktopName=icewm
|
||||
+
|
||||
+[Window Manager]
|
||||
+Name=icewm
|
||||
+SessionManaged=false
|
||||
+StartupNotification=false
|
@ -3,6 +3,8 @@ Tue Mar 8 12:25:59 UTC 2016 - tchvatal@suse.com
|
||||
|
||||
- Add back icewm menu as it is used by us
|
||||
* icewm-susemenu.patch
|
||||
- Add patch to fix icewm session desktop files
|
||||
* icewm-session-desktop.patch
|
||||
|
||||
-------------------------------------------------------------------
|
||||
Thu Feb 18 11:27:10 UTC 2016 - alarrosa@suse.com
|
||||
|
@ -30,6 +30,8 @@ Source1: icewm.desktop
|
||||
Patch0: icewm-mate.patch
|
||||
# PATCH-FEATURE-SUSE icewm-susemenu.patch tyang@suse.com -- Add xdg-menu for SLED icewm
|
||||
Patch1: icewm-susemenu.patch
|
||||
# PATCH-FIX-UPSTREAM tweak the desktop session files to work correctly
|
||||
Patch2: icewm-session-desktop.patch
|
||||
Patch99: icewm-preferences.patch
|
||||
BuildRequires: autoconf
|
||||
BuildRequires: automake
|
||||
@ -129,6 +131,7 @@ mailbox status, and a digital clock. It is fast and small.
|
||||
%setup -q
|
||||
%patch0 -p1
|
||||
%patch1 -p1
|
||||
%patch2 -p1
|
||||
# Do not require needlessly new gettext.
|
||||
sed -i 's/0.19.6/0.18.3/g' configure.ac
|
||||
|
||||
|
Loading…
x
Reference in New Issue
Block a user